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72 192716314 888393
8312018652 74661823
8312018652 74661823
080098 242 466153
All about undefined
Interested in learning more?
8312018652 74661823
080098 242 466153
See more
62698374 77 533342273
82494 051 51021
See more
113 03525176221 866
897699 19933922 1832
See more